1. Understanding Fridge Configurations
Before looking at brands, you should select the type of configuration that suits your cooking area layout and way of life.
Freestanding vs. IntegratedFreestanding: These designs are created to be visible. They are easier to install and replace, and they often can be found in a broader range of sizes and finishes (stainless steel, matte black, etc).Integrated (Built-in): These are hidden behind a furnishings door to match the rest of your cooking area cabinetry. They use a smooth appearance but are generally smaller and more costly Best Place To Buy Refrigerator Online install.Style VariationsLarder Fridges: These have no freezer compartment. They provide optimal rack area for fresh food, ideal for big families or those with a different chest freezer.Fridge-Freezers: The basic choice for a lot of UK homes. You can select a "top-mount" (freezer on top), "bottom-mount" (freezer on bottom), or side-by-side.American-Style: Large, double-door units. These often consist of water and ice dispensers however need substantial kitchen area and often a dedicated plumbing line.2. Secret Features to Compare
When searching, focus on technical specs instead of just looks.
Energy Efficiency
With UK energy expenses fluctuating, the energy score is paramount. Search for the modern-day A-G labels. While A-rated fridges are more costly upfront, the long-lasting electrical energy savings are considerable.
Capability (Litres)
Fridge capability is determined in litres. A basic guideline is:
1-- 2 people: 150-- 250 litres3-- 4 people: 250-- 350 litres5+ individuals: 350+ litresCooling TechnologyFrost-Free: A non-negotiable function. It prevents ice accumulation, suggesting you never ever need to manually defrost your freezer.Multi-Airflow: Ensures even cooling throughout the fridge, preventing "hot spots" that can cause food to spoil prematurely.Humidity Controlled Drawers: Essential for keeping vegetables and fruits crisp for longer.3. Measuring Your Space: The Golden Rule
Before buying, measure your available area:
Width/Height/Depth: Don't just measure the space; determine your entrances and hallways to ensure the system can in fact reach the kitchen!Ventilation Gap: Always leave a minimum of 5cm of space on the sides and top, and 10cm at the back to enable the fridge to "breathe" and run efficiently.Door Swing: Ensure there suffices clearance for the doors to open totally without hitting walls or cabinets.5. Maintenance Tips for Longevity
Once you have actually bought your ideal fridge, follow these actions to maintain optimal performance:
Clean the Coils: Dust accumulation on the condenser coils (normally at the back) requires the motor to work harder. Vacuum these a minimum of once a year.Check Door Seals: If the rubber seal is split, cold air will get away. Test it by closing the door on a piece of paper; if you can pull the paper out easily, it's time for a replacement.Do not Overpack: Air needs to circulate to maintain temperature level. An overstuffed fridge works less efficiently.Examine the Temperature: Keep your fridge in between 1 ° C and 4 ° C and your freezer at -18 ° C.6. Q: Are integrated fridges more costly than freestanding?A: Generally, yes. Not only is the device itself often more costly, however the setup costs are higher since they need custom cabinetry and professional fitting.
Q: How much space do I need for a fridge?A: You need to constantly permit at least 5cm of clearance on all sides to permit proper airflow. Without this, your fridge will overheat and most likely fail too soon.
Q: What does "frost-free" imply?A: A frost-free fridge uses a fan to circulate air, avoiding the formation of ice crystals. It removes the requirement for manual defrosting, which is a significant time-saver for any property owner.
Q: Should I purchase a fridge with an ice dispenser?A: They are hassle-free, but remember that plumbed-in designs require professional installation. If you choose a non-plumbed design, you will have to fill a water reservoir by hand. They likewise lose a small amount of internal storage space in the door.
Q: How long should a modern Best Fridge Online last?A: A well-maintained fridge needs to last between 10 and 15 years. Regular cleaning of the condenser coils and seal upkeep can help you reach the upper end of that variety.
